首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

视图输入值绑定不正确,而隐藏值绑定没有问题

,这个问题可能是由于前端开发中的数据绑定错误导致的。数据绑定是前端开发中常用的技术,用于将数据与视图进行关联,实现数据的动态展示和交互。

在前端开发中,视图输入值绑定通常是通过表单元素(如input、select、textarea等)与数据模型之间建立关联,以实现用户输入的数据与后端进行交互。而隐藏值绑定则是将数据存储在隐藏的表单元素中,用于在后端进行处理或传递数据。

当视图输入值绑定不正确时,可能会导致用户输入的数据无法正确传递给后端,或者后端返回的数据无法正确显示在视图上。这可能是由于以下原因导致的:

  1. 数据绑定表达式错误:在前端开发中,数据绑定通常使用模板语法或框架提供的指令来实现,如果表达式书写错误,就会导致绑定不正确。开发者需要仔细检查绑定表达式的语法和逻辑是否正确。
  2. 数据模型与视图不匹配:数据模型是前端开发中存储数据的对象,而视图是用户界面的展示部分。如果数据模型与视图的结构不匹配,就会导致绑定不正确。开发者需要确保数据模型的属性与视图元素的绑定关系正确。
  3. 数据类型转换错误:在数据绑定过程中,有时需要进行数据类型的转换,例如将字符串转换为数字或布尔值。如果转换过程中出现错误,就会导致绑定不正确。开发者需要确保数据类型转换的逻辑正确。

针对这个问题,可以采取以下解决方法:

  1. 检查数据绑定表达式:仔细检查视图输入值的绑定表达式,确保语法和逻辑正确。可以参考相关文档或教程,学习正确的数据绑定方式。
  2. 验证数据模型与视图的匹配:确保数据模型的属性与视图元素的绑定关系正确,包括名称、类型和结构等方面。可以使用调试工具或打印日志来检查数据模型的状态。
  3. 检查数据类型转换:如果涉及到数据类型的转换,例如将字符串转换为数字,需要确保转换过程正确。可以使用相关的转换函数或方法来进行数据类型的转换。

对于腾讯云相关产品的推荐,可以考虑使用以下产品来支持云计算领域的开发和部署:

  1. 云服务器(CVM):提供弹性的虚拟服务器实例,可用于搭建应用程序、网站和服务等。
  2. 云数据库 MySQL版(CDB):提供稳定可靠的关系型数据库服务,支持高可用、备份恢复和自动扩展等功能。
  3. 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各类非结构化数据。
  4. 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,可用于开发智能化的应用程序。
  5. 云函数(SCF):提供事件驱动的无服务器计算服务,可用于编写和运行无需管理服务器的代码。

以上是腾讯云的一些产品,可以根据具体需求选择适合的产品来支持云计算领域的开发工作。具体产品介绍和更多信息可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何让 SwiftUI 的列表变得更加灵活

前言 List 可能是 SwiftUI 附带的内置视图中最常用的一种,它使我们能够在任何 Apple 平台上呈现“类似于表格视图”的用户界面。...元素绑定和自定义滑动操作 接下来,让我们看看如何将完全自定义的滑动操作添加到列表中。...然后,让我们使用另一个新功能,集合元素绑定,让系统自动为我们的 articles 数组中的每个元素创建一个可变绑定: struct ArticleList: View { @ObservedObject...,即使我们的应用程序在较旧的操作系统版本上运行,也是没有问题的。...由于每个 article 在 ForEach 闭包中都是可变的,我们可以使用新的 swipeActions 修饰符来实现每个 NavigationLink 项目视图的自定义滑动操作。

4.9K41

详细介绍AngularJS中与HTML DOM交互的各种方法和技术

-- 应用程序内容 -->ng-modelng-model指令用于将HTML元素的绑定到AngularJS应用程序中的变量。它使得数据的双向绑定变得容易。...例如,下面的代码将一个输入框的与名为"username"的变量进行双向绑定:当用户输入时,变量"username"的将自动更新...反之,当变量"username"的改变时,输入框中的也将更新。ng-show/ng-hideng-show和ng-hide指令用于根据条件显示或隐藏HTML元素。...通过在控制器中设置属性和方法,可以将数据传递给视图,以及从视图接收用户的输入。...通过服务,我们可以在控制器和视图之间建立通信,并与服务器进行数据交互。AngularJS使得与HTML DOM的交互变得简单强大,帮助我们构建功能丰富的Web应用程序。

24720
  • Vue初步认识与Vue基础指令

    单向数据绑定 对于输入框等可输入元素,可设置双向数据绑定 双向数据绑定是在数据绑定基础上,可自动将元素输入内容更新给数据, 实现数据与元素内容的双向绑定。...模型实现的数据驱动视图解放了DOM操作 View 与 Model 处理分离,降低代码耦合度 但双向绑定时的 Bug 调试难度增大 (有可能出现在视图或者数据层) 大型项目的 View 与 Model 过多...特点: data中的数据是直接可以在视图中通过插表达式访问 data的数据为响应式数据,发生改变时,视图会自动更新 特殊情况: data中存在数组时,索引操作和length操作无法自动更新视图...item in obj"> {{ item }} 结果 v-show 指令 用于控制元素显示与隐藏...,适用于显示隐藏频繁切换的时候使用 v-show内部的数据也可以通过data设置达到控制的效果 也可以通过条件表达式来控制 标签内容

    3.1K30

    隐式数据类型转换案例一则

    在OLTP系统中,要求对频繁执行的SQL使用绑定变量(唯一少的字段,如type、status等,数据分布不均是常见情况,这种字段不建议使用绑定变量)。...根据常理,只有执行计划1才是比较正常的性能表现。...再看SQL执行情况,1和2两个计划同时存在,效率差别非常明显: 再来分别看3个执行计划的具体内容: 执行计划1,plan_hash_value=1228755719,使用了ACC_NBR字段上的索引,没有问题...经过开发人员对代码的核对,发现这段SQL在两个不同的代码段中被调用,一段代码使用了正确的绑定变量类型(varchar2),另一段则使用了number类型的绑定变量,这就造成了同一个sql_id, 同时存在多个不同执行计划的情况...有的DBA在遇到这种多个执行计划同时存在的情况(这个情况比较特殊),可能会考虑使用SQL profile来固定执行计划,但是固定的执行计划只对正确使用绑定变量类型的SQL生效,对于不正确绑定变量类型,SQL

    41820

    懂个锤子Vue 项目工程化扩展:

    3.0: 懂个锤子Vue、WebPack5.0、WebPack高级进阶 涉及的技术栈…学习前置链接: 懂个锤子Vue 项目工程化 懂个锤子Vue 项目工程化进阶⏫,上述学习了Vue组件的很多种通信方式,除此之外还有很多隐藏的组件通信方式...;双向绑定: 指在视图View 和数据模型Model 之间建立的一种同步机制,通过这种机制:当视图中的数据发生变化时,数据模型会自动更新,同样,当数据模型发生变化时,视图也会自动更新双向同步的特性使得数据和视图之间的交互变得更加简便和高效...;它的本质是一种语法糖,简化了数据绑定和事件监听的过程:其原理: 数据绑定:v-model 将表单控件的value,绑定到 Vue 实例的数据属性;事件监听:v-model 监听用户对表单控件的输入事件...,如 input 事件,并在用户输入时自动更新数据属性的视图更新:当数据属性的发生变化时,v-model 自动更新表单控件的,确保视图和数据的同步; <div id="app...内部转换为value的prop和input事件的监听;在一个组件中只能有一个v-model,因为它代表单一的数据<em>绑定</em>点;固定了父——子组件传递<em>值</em>:value总结:适用场景:v-model更适合简单的表单<em>输入</em>双向<em>绑定</em>

    7910

    前端三大框架之Vue-day01

    ,但是没有闪动问题 如果数据中有HTML标签会将html标签一并输出 注意:此处为单向绑定,数据对象上的改变,插会发生变化;但是当插发生变化并不会影响数据对象的 ...Vue 中 view 即 我们的HTML页面 vm (view-model) 控制器 将数据和视图层建立联系 vm 即 Vue 的实例 就是 vm v-on 用来绑定事件的 形式如:v-on:click...注意:v-bind:class指令可以与普通的class特性共存 1、 v-bind 中支持绑定一个对象 如果绑定的是一个对象 则 键为 对应的类名 为对应data中的数据 <!...的区别 绑定对象的时候 对象的属性 即要渲染的类名 对象的属性对应的是 data 中的数据 绑定数组的时候数组里面存的是data 中的数据 绑定style <div v-bind:style="styleObject...v-show只编译一次,后面其实就是控制css,<em>而</em>v-if不停的销毁和创建,故v-show性能更好一点。

    1.7K10

    vue入门

    注意:数据驱动视图是单向的数据绑定。 ### 推荐大家安装的 VScode 中的 Vue 插件 1....+ js 数据的变化,会被自动渲染到页面上 + 页面上表单采集的数据发生变化的时候,会被 vue 自动获取到,并更新到 js 数据中 > 注意:数据驱动视图和双向数据绑定的底层原理是 MVVM(Mode...数据源、View 视图、ViewModel 就是 vue 的实例(数据双向绑定)) ### vue 指令 #### 1....属性绑定指令 > 注意:插表达式只能用在元素的**内容节点**中,不能用在元素的**属性节点**中!...+ 在 vue 中,可以使用 `v-bind:` 指令,为元素的属性动态绑定; + 简写是英文的 `:` + 在使用 v-bind 属性绑定期间,如果绑定内容需要进行动态拼接,则字符串的外面应该包裹单引号

    69640

    Vue模板语法

    ” 如何解决该问题:使用v-cloak指令 解决该问题的原理:先隐藏,替换好之后再显示最终的  /*   1、通过属性选择器...html标签一并输出 注意:此处为单向绑定,数据对象上的改变,插会发生变化;但是当插发生变化并不会影响数据对象的    <!...① 数据绑定:将数据填充到标签中 v-once 只编译一次 ① 显示内容之后不再具有响应式功能 v-once 执行一次性的插【当数据改变时,插处的内容不会继续更新】 v-once...注意:v-bind:class指令可以与普通的class特性共存 //1、 v-bind 中支持绑定一个对象 如果绑定的是一个对象 则 键为 对应的类名 为对应data中的数据 ​ <head...分支结构 v-if 使用场景 1- 多个元素 通过条件判断展示或者隐藏某个元素。或者多个元素 2- 进行两个视图之间的切换        <!

    6.7K40

    前端知识点总结vue篇(下)

    MVVM模型 第一个M是Model,数据模型 第二个V是View,代表UI组件 VM为viewModel视图模型,是view和model的桥梁,同时监听模型数据以及控制视图行为。...数据绑定到viewmodel层并自动渲染 到页面中,视图变化通知viewmodel层更新数据。 4. vue常用的一些指令 v-if:根据表达式的的真假条件渲染元素。...在切换时元素及它的数据绑定 / 组件被销毁并重建。 v-show:根据表达式之真假,切换元素的 display CSS 属性。...绑定事件监听器。 v-model:实现表单输入和应用状态之间的双向绑定 v-pre:跳过这个元素和它的子元素的编译过程。可以用来显示原始 Mustache 标签。跳过大量没有指令的节点会加快编译。...如果是函数的话,每个实例可以维护一份返回对象的独立拷贝,组件实例之间的data属性不会相互影响。

    34820

    TDesign 更新周报(2022年9月第4周)

    ,缺少判空,tdesign-vue-nex#1704 @chaishi (#1562)修复视图切换或表格变化的场景下 吸顶吸底效果没有重新渲染计算的问题 issue#1529 @uyarn (#1570...yusongH (#1717)修复 trriger 属性不生效问题 @yusongH (#1717)修复鼠标悬停移出后没有重新轮播问题 @yusongH (#1717)修复 swiper 组件的 demo 显示不正确...fallback value 保证颜色展示正确 @LeeJim (#875)Icon: 移除 CSS 属性 speak @anlyyao (#885)Textarea: 修复 maxLength 情况下,显示和实际不一致问题... @anlyyao (#883)Textarea: 修复 maxcharacter 情况下,输入超出 maxcharacter 的问题 @anlyyao (#883)Input: 修复 maxcharacter...情况下,输入超出 maxcharacter 的问题 @anlyyao (#883)DateTimePicker: 修复选项重置错误的问题 @LeeJim (#888)详情见:https://github.com

    1.2K10

    Mac开发之 Cocoa 绑定 入门

    3.绑定简单使用方式 3.1 视图(View)绑定到模型(Model) 将视图绑定到模型对象,就是告诉视图需要显示的内容来自哪里(通常是数据模型对象的某个属性),以及什么时候更新显示内容.当数据模型的某一属性的发生改变时...可以将视图的许多不同属性绑定到某一(或多个)模型的属性上.能够绑定的具体视图属性会因视图不同不同....的score属性进行了绑定,这样当score数值发生变化的时候,绑定系统就会通知Label更新Values的内容) 设置Label绑定 (6) 绑定Slider到控制器的son属性的score 设置...添加代码 当son的score发生变化时,Label和Slider会同时更新它们的显示.我们没有在视图和数据直接添加任何数据传递的代码,就完成了它们之间的相互联系,由此可见,cocoa绑定为我们节省了代码量...,简化了开发步骤,同时也减少了Bug的可能. 3.2 绑定到控制器 在刚刚的例子中,我们将视图直接绑定在模型对象的属性上,跳过了控制器,这种情况对应简单的使用没有问题,但绑定还有更多的使用方式,也许你在签名的例子中已经注意到了

    1.9K20

    Java浅拷贝BeanUtils.copyProperties引发的RPC异常

    ,转换完成后将通过表达式引擎解析表达式并取得正确的,通过事件解析引擎解析用户自定义事件并完成事件的绑定,完成解析赋值以及事件绑定后进行视图的渲染,最终将目标页面展示到屏幕。...L同学确认自己逻辑没有问题后,同步B同学和S同学,看内部是否有什么处理逻辑。。。 3、第二天早上一来,快速写了单测,确认服务端收到的报文格式,的确没有问题。于是乎,开始扒代码。。。...return cargoInfo; }).collect(Collectors.toList()); } PS:客户端&服务端类关系 因为BeanUtils.copyProperties属于浅拷贝,浅拷贝只是调用子对象的...03 解决方案与后续反思 理解,首先 MCube 会依据模板缓存状态判断是否需要网络获取最新模板,当获取到模板后进行模板加载,加载阶段会将产物转换为视图树的结构,转换完成后将通过表达式引擎解析表达式并取得正确的...,通过事件解析引擎解析用户自定义事件并完成事件的绑定,完成解析赋值以及事件绑定后进行视图的渲染,最终将目标页面展示到屏幕。

    12010

    【VUE】基础用法(属性与事件的绑定,条件渲染等)

    注意:数据驱动视图是单向的数据绑定。    双向数据绑定 在填写表单时,双向数据绑定可以辅助开发者在不操作DOM的前提下,自动把用户填写的内容同步到数据源中。...MVVM MVVM是vue实现数据驱动视图和双向数据绑定的核心原理,MVVM指的是Model,View和View Model,它把每个HTML页面都拆分成了这三个部分。...如果需要为元素的属性动态绑定属性,则需要用到v-bind属性绑定指令,可以直接简写成:....在输入输入完成后,点击esc将清空输入框,点击enter将触发ajax事件,我们可以直接使用按键修饰符,给具体的按键绑定事件函数。...-- v-if v-show都是控制元素的显示与隐藏 v-if是动态添加或删除元素 v-show是display:none隐藏 --> 这是被

    1.5K20

    前端成神之路-vue01

    标签一并输出 注意:此处为单向绑定,数据对象上的改变,插会发生变化;但是当插发生变化并不会影响数据对象的 <!...Vue 中 view 即 我们的HTML页面 vm (view-model) 控制器 将数据和视图层建立联系 vm 即 Vue 的实例 就是 vm v-on 用来绑定事件的 形式如:v-on:click...注意:v-bind:class指令可以与普通的class特性共存 1、 v-bind 中支持绑定一个对象 如果绑定的是一个对象 则 键为 对应的类名 为对应data中的数据 <!...的区别 绑定对象的时候 对象的属性 即要渲染的类名 对象的属性对应的是 data 中的数据 绑定数组的时候数组里面存的是data 中的数据 绑定style <div v-bind:style="styleObject...v-show只编译一次,后面其实就是控制css,<em>而</em>v-if不停的销毁和创建,故v-show性能更好一点。

    1.1K20

    vue封装带提示框的单选多选文本框组件

    拼装到输入框中,反之删除key,同时允许用户自由输入。...组件的模板结构如下,通过show变量控制提示框的显示与隐藏,在组件的输入绑定聚焦和失焦事件: @focus="onfocus" 和 @blur="onblur",在focus时设置变量show为true...对于多选,此时不应该关闭提示框,所有问题的关键在于如何实现点击提示选项隐藏提示框。 ?...4.2 输入与选中状态双向绑定 对于输入和选中状态的处理,根据需求,选项与输入能够双向绑定。...为了避免循环更新,此处只对输入添加watcher监听器,用户手动输入数据,触发监听器更新选中状态;用户选择或取消选择选项,则直接更新对应的输入。 ?

    7.8K30
    领券